Bullish Consecutive Signal
- Indicadores
- Hyoseog Kim
- Versión: 1.0
Señal Consecutiva Alcista - Señal de compra de velas alcistas consecutivas con alertas y simulación de pérdidas y ganancias
Bullish Consecutive Signal detecta automáticamente patrones de velas alcistas consecutivas y marca entradas de compra de alta probabilidad directamente en el gráfico. Cada señal viene con un nivel de Stop Loss y Take Profit calculados mediante ATR, dibujados como líneas de referencia para que pueda evaluar el riesgo de un vistazo. Una simulación retrospectiva de pérdidas y ganancias incorporada le permite evaluar el rendimiento de la estrategia sin salir del gráfico.
Si aplica este indicador a un símbolo o marco temporal diferente, los resultados pueden variar significativamente. Realice siempre pruebas retrospectivas y ajuste los filtros, los multiplicadores ATR y los periodos MA antes de utilizar el indicador en un entorno en vivo.
"Sim trigger (true = run immediately)" a true para que se ejecute en la siguiente carga.
La configuración por defecto está ajustada para XAUUSD M1. Otros símbolos y plazos requieren pruebas individuales y la optimización de los parámetros.
Descripciones de los parámetros (Todos los valores por defecto están calibrados para XAUUSD en el gráfico M1).
Parámetro Descripción Predeterminado
── Condiciones de la señal ──
InpBullCount Número de velas alcistas consecutivas necesarias para confirmar una señal de compra. Una vela es alcista cuando Close > Open. Valores más altos producen menos señales pero potencialmente más fuertes. 3
Filtro de media móvil ──
InpShortMAPer Periodo de la EMA a corto plazo utilizado para la alineación de MA y el filtrado de posiciones abiertas. 7
InpLongMAPer Periodo de la EMA a largo plazo utilizado para la alineación de MA y el filtrado de posiciones abiertas. 30
InpMACond Requisito de alineación de MA. Golden Cross: la EMA corta debe estar por encima de la EMA larga. Dead Cross: short debe estar por debajo de long. Desactivado: no se aplica comprobación de alineación. Desactivado
InpOpenFilter Requiere que el precio de apertura de la barra de señal esté por debajo de la EMA seleccionada. Below Short MA filtra entradas pullback contra la EMA corta. Por debajo de la MA larga utiliza la EMA larga. Deshabilitado: sin filtro de posición. Below Short MA
InpMADistMin Distancia mínima entre las EMAs corta y larga. Establecer a 0 para desactivar. Útil para filtrar condiciones de mercado planas y sin tendencia. 0.0
Bandas de Bollinger ──
InpBBPeriod Periodo de las Bandas de Bollinger utilizado para el filtro de toque de banda inferior. 20
InpBBDev Multiplicador de la desviación estándar para las bandas de Bollinger. 2.0
InpBBTouch Cuando es verdadero, al menos una vela en la secuencia alcista debe haber tocado o cruzado la Banda de Bollinger inferior. Añade una condición de reversión media a la entrada. false
── Configuración de ATR SL / TP ──
InpATRPeriod Periodo utilizado para calcular el Average True Range (ATR) para la colocación dinámica de SL y TP. 14
InpATRMultSL Multiplicador ATR para el Stop Loss. SL = Entrada - (ATR × este valor). Auméntelo para dar más margen a la operación; disminúyalo para un stop más ajustado. 1.5
InpATRMultTP Multiplicador ATR para el Take Profit. TP = Entrada + (ATR × este valor). El ajuste por defecto produce una relación recompensa-riesgo de 2 : 1 (3,0 ÷ 1,5). 3,0
InpLineBars Número de barras que las líneas de referencia SL / TP / Entrada se extienden a la derecha de la barra de señal. Sólo cosmético; no afecta a los cálculos. 8
── Filtro ① - Rango RSI ──
InpRsiEnable Activa el filtro de rango RSI. Cuando está activo, sólo se acepta una señal si el valor RSI se encuentra dentro de [InpRsiMin, InpRsiMax]. false
InpRsiPeriod Periodo de cálculo del RSI. 14
InpRsiMin Límite inferior del rango RSI aceptable. Las señales con RSI por debajo de este valor son rechazadas. 35.0
InpRsiMax Límite superior del rango RSI aceptable. Las señales con RSI por encima de este valor son rechazadas. 60.0
── Filtro ② - Fuerza de la tendencia ADX ──
InpAdxEnable Activa el filtro de fuerza ADX. Cuando está activo, sólo se aceptan señales cuando el ADX está por encima de InpAdxMin, lo que indica un mercado en tendencia en lugar de oscilante. true
InpAdxPeriod Periodo de cálculo del ADX. 7
InpAdxMin Valor mínimo de ADX necesario para pasar el filtro. Un valor de 20 es un umbral ampliamente utilizado para un mercado en tendencia; los valores más bajos son más permisivos. 19.0
── Filtro ③ - Dirección MA a largo plazo ──
InpTrendMAEnable Activa el filtro de dirección MA de tendencia. Cuando está activo, las señales deben alinearse con la posición del precio relativa a la EMA lenta. false
InpTrendMAPer Periodo de la EMA lenta de tendencia (por ejemplo, 200 para la EMA clásica de 200). 200
InpTrendMAAbove Cuando es verdadero, sólo se aceptan señales cuando el precio (barra abierta) está por encima de la EMA de tendencia - sesgo alcista. Cuando es falso, sólo se aceptan señales por debajo de la EMA - sesgo bajista / modo contra-tendencia. true
── Filtro ④ - Tamaño del cuerpo de la vela ──
InpBodyEnable Activa el filtro de tamaño de cuerpo de vela. Rechaza las señales en las que el cuerpo medio de la vela de la secuencia alcista es demasiado pequeño en relación con el ATR. true
InpBodyMinRatio Tamaño mínimo requerido del cuerpo expresado como porcentaje del ATR. El cuerpo medio de la secuencia alcista debe ser igual o superior a (ATR × InpBodyMinRatio / 100). Aumentar para requerir un mayor impulso alcista. 7.0
── Filtro ⑤ - Sesión de negociación ──
InpTimeEnable Activa el filtro de hora de la sesión. Cuando está activo, se ignoran las señales fuera del rango horario definido. false
InpTimeStart Hora de inicio de la sesión (hora del servidor, 0-23). Se permiten señales en esta hora o después de ella. 7
InpTimeEnd Hora de fin de sesión (hora del servidor, 0-23). Se permiten señales antes de esta hora. Si InpTimeEnd < InpTimeStart el filtro rodea la medianoche (por ejemplo, 22:00-06:00). 21
── Alertas en directo ──
InpAlertPopup Activa una alerta emergente en pantalla cada vez que se detecta una nueva señal en la última barra completada. true
InpAlertEmail Envía una alerta por correo electrónico en cada nueva señal. Requiere ajustes SMTP configurados en MT5 Herramientas → Opciones → Correo electrónico. false
InpAlertPush Envía una notificación push a la aplicación móvil MetaQuotes en cada nueva señal. Requiere un MetaQuotes ID registrado en MT5 Tools → Options → Notifications. false
Simulación
InpSimDays Número de días naturales a incluir en la simulación retrospectiva de P&L, medidos hacia atrás desde la barra actual. Haga clic en el botón "[ Ejecutar Simulación ]" del gráfico para ejecutarla. 100
InpSimLots Tamaño del lote utilizado para calcular el P&L simulado en dólares para cada operación. No afecta a la detección de señales. 0.1
InpSimTrigger Establecer a true para ejecutar la simulación automáticamente en la carga del indicador, sin hacer clic en el botón. Útil en cuentas reales donde los eventos de clic en objetos gráficos pueden no dispararse correctamente. false

